Arkansas Drug Take Back Day Set For Oct. 25

Arkansas officials are encouraging residents to safely and anonymously dispose of unused or unwanted medications during the state’s annual Drug Take Back Day on Friday, Oct. 25. Agencies concerned as government shutdown enters third day

LITTLE ROCK  — The federal government shutdown has entered its third day, and anxiety is lingering across Arkansas. The Little Rock NAACP says the shutdown could disproportionately harm underserved communities who rely on government-funded assistance like SNAP or HUD. State Insurance Day set Tuesday

The Arkansas Insurance Department will host the second annual Arkansas Insurance Day (I-Day) on Tuesday, September 23, 2025, at the DoubleTree by Hilton in Little Rock.
